About the Book: Churchill’s Queen explores the extraordinary friendship between Queen Elizabeth II and Winston Churchill, two of Britain’s most influential historical figures. Drawing on previously unpublished government records and private archives, the book reveals how Churchill guided the young monarch during the early years of her reign, while Elizabeth helped shape his final chapter with dignity and respect. This fascinating historical biography examines leadership, duty, politics, and the personal bond between a legendary prime minister and a remarkable queen.
